Not Sure Where to Apply?

Northcoders

Online, Manchester, Leeds, Newcastle, +1 more.
Birmingham

About Northcoders

Location: Online, Manchester, Leeds, Newcastle, Birmingham

Northcoders are a multi-award-winning provider of coding bootcamps, offering life-changing opportunities for people wanting to get into the tech industry.

Their 13-week intensive bootcamps equip graduates with all the skills and knowledge they need to... Read More

There are many ways to pay, including free scholarships for people living in England, and finance options for those that live in other parts of the UK.

Courses

Data Engineering Bootcamp

Cost: £6,450
Duration: 13 weeks
Locations: Online, Manchester, Leeds, Newcastle, Birmingham
In-person Available Online
Course Description:

This 13 week bootcamp focuses specifically on “the back end” of software. Here is a breakdown of the course:

Week 1: Introduction Week
We’ll use the first week to introduce Python, get used to understanding its syntax, and establish good working practices. As well as Python-specific code, we’ll start discussing universal concepts like algorithms, problem-solving and regular expressions.
Weeks 2-4: Fundamentals
You’ll gain a rigorous understanding of the core concepts and best practices of Python programming. You’ll cover test-driven development, programming paradigms like functional and object-oriented programming and how to write succinct Pythonic code.
Week 5: Data Fundamentals
This is where we introduce the basics of how data is stored, analysed and manipulated. A key element is Structured Query Language which is the near-universal standard for interacting with relational databases.
Week 6: Back End Fundamentals
Data Engineering is an inherently back-end discipline and it’s important to know the principles and practice of how to create servers and APIs and how they interact with data sources.
Weeks 7-8: Cloud Engineering and DevOps
We will explore how to deploy data applications in the market-leading cloud stack, AWS. Additionally, we’ll go into the key skills of DevOps - infrastructure-as-code (IaC) and continuous integration/deployment (CI/CD).
Weeks 9-10: Data Engineering Techniques
Using the fundamentals you have learned about Python programming, data and cloud engineering, you will learn about the standard skills of ETL, Orchestration, modelling for data analytics and Business Intelligence.
Weeks 11-13: Project Phase
You’ll work in teams of 4-6 to develop a realistic data application. During the first week, you will learn best practices for working in technology teams, such as utilising Kanban, being introduced to Agile methodologies, writing user stories, conducting effective stand-up meetings, and collaborating on Git.

Subjects:
Data Engineering, Agile, React.js, SQL, JavaScript, Python

Java Development Bootcamp

Cost: £6,450
Duration: 13 weeks
Locations: Online, Manchester, Leeds, Newcastle, Birmingham
In-person Available Online
Course Description:

Our latest bootcamp is tailored for one of today's most vital tech skills - Java development. As the tech landscape evolves, Java continues to be one of the most in demand languages in software development, as well as being highly valued across various industries. Here is a breakdown of the course:

Week 1: Introduction Week
Kick-start your Java journey with confidence-building sessions on Java basics, tools, terminals, IDEs, and version control with Git and GitHub. We'll also delve into the art of pseudocoding to lay a strong foundation.
Weeks 2-3: Object-Oriented Programming and Software Testing
Gain a solid grasp of Java programming fundamentals. We'll focus on object-oriented principles, diving into classes, inheritance, and interfaces, ensuring you understand the core elements of Java development. Emphasis will be placed on test-driven development to enhance your coding proficiency and software quality.
Weeks 4-5: Advanced Java
Building on the basics, we'll explore advanced Java topics like functional programming, asynchronous code and lambda expressions. At the end of this block, you’ll build a mini test-driven project to combine everything you’ve learned so far.
Weeks 6-8: Data Management and Web Backends
Dive into the world of databases and APIs. Learn about SQL, database management, and how to create robust APIs using Spring Boot, a crucial skill for backend development.
Week 9: Cloud Deployment and Software Architecture
Expand your skill set to include cloud deployment using Docker and the basics of software architecture. This knowledge is key for modern software development and deployment practices.
Weeks 10-13: Frontend Development and Mobile App Project
Transition into frontend development by creating both HTML web pages and Android mobile apps before applying your comprehensive skills in a capstone project. You'll create a Java-based backend application with an Android mobile frontend, showcasing your full-stack development abilities.

Subjects:
Java, SQL, HTML

Software Development Bootcamp

Cost: £8,500
Duration: 13 weeks
Locations: Online, Manchester, Leeds, Newcastle, Birmingham
In-person Available Online
Course Description:

Across 13 weeks we cover a mixture of back-end and front-end with a focus on building web applications. Here is a breakdown of the course:

Week 1: Introduction Week
We'll begin by helping you build your confidence with JavaScript, laying the
foundations for you to be able to handle data and create interactivity on websites and apps. We'll also provide you with resources to help you build your HTML and CSS skills.
Weeks 2-4: Fundamentals
First things first. We’ll give you a solid understanding of the fundamentals and best practices of programming. We'll cover test-driven development, pair programming, object-oriented programming and a range of other core tools and workplace practices through the medium of JavaScript.
Weeks 5-7: Back End
JavaScript is the only language that can be run both on the front and back end. Once you’ve mastered the fundamentals of coding in JavaScript, we show you how we can use use Node.js to run code for the back end, and focus on ways of dealing with asynchronous programming. We'll look at APIs and databases, and cover Express and SQL. We’ll also work with some pretty cool third-party data sets and APIs, and help you deploy applications to the cloud!
Weeks 8-10: Front End
It's front end next - you'll learn all about the DOM (Document Object Model) and how to make accessible websites with semantic HTML and responsive CSS, and we'll introduce you to UX. React is the most in-demand front-end framework. We'll teach you the latest concepts and some key peripheral technologies so you can create entire complex front-ends for your websites.
Weeks 11-13: Project Phase
There's no better way to consolidate and extend your knowledge, and prove what you can do, than to get hands on with a real, green-field team project. With previous groups exploring Virtual Reality, Machine Learning, image recognition and blockchain (to name a few!); what you create is limited by your imagination. Curious as to what our previous graduates have created?

Northcoders Reviews

Average Ratings (All Programs)

Northcoders logo

4.68/5 (62 reviews)

Stephen Molano-James
Customer Success Engineer | Graduated: 2024

3/19/2024

Course
Data Engineering Bootcamp

Overall

Curriculum

Job Support

"The real deal, worth every penny"

I found Northcoders while on my honeymoon, browsing on Instagram, many courses claim that they can get you into work, that you will be a full software dev in 12 weeks, Northcoders delivered. From day one, you get to learn the basics of Javascript, before... Read More

Krasen Hristov
Graduated: 2024

2/27/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Amazing for the most part"

This course offers a well-structured, in-depth exploration of many important topics. The mentors were knowledgeable and provided excellent support. However, the graduation policy seems quite lenient. While this makes the course accessible, it can be challenging... Read More

Anonymous
Junior Developer | Graduated: 2023

2/22/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Great tuition, but be wary of the job market"

The tuition provided by the teaching team at Northcoders is genuinely excellent. They have all the time in the world for students and the tutors genuinely care about your success. The content is taught in a super accessible manner, and the process has... Read More

Muhammad Yoosuf Ahmad
Games Development Mentor | Graduated: 2023

2/20/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Excellent Stepping Stone"

I kick-started my tech career using the Northcoders bootcamp as a stepping stone. The opportunities are endless once you've got a solid grounding in a popular programming language like JavaScript. This will allow you to explore many different options... Read More

Anonymous
Customer Success Engineer | Graduated: 2024

2/10/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Review for boot camp"

The course is very structured and organized. They teach you enough coding fundamentals to carry on studying coding on your own after the course is finished. The job searching support was great. They helped with preparing CV and interview which was amazing.... Read More

Harry Walker
Software Engineer | Graduated: 2023

2/10/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Cannot recommend enough!"

I was an Actor who wanted to pursue a career as a Software Developer with ZERO experience. Northcoders fast-tracked me into the field, teaching me all the fundamental practical knowledge necessary. Moreover, the content was delivered in an engaging way... Read More

Anonymous
Software developer trainee | Graduated: 2023

1/26/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Good course, great job support"

It was a life changing course that was funded by the DFE for myself. However I am going to review this based on the course cost which is £8000. Pros: Great teaching from seminar leads, brilliant detail and extremely helpful and reassuring, would go over... Read More

Anonymous
Junior Data Engineer | Graduated: 2023

1/23/2024

Course
Data Engineering Bootcamp

Overall

Curriculum

Job Support

"Overall an excellent bootcamp!"

Pros: Excellent teaching, good mix of independent work, pair programming and lectures, kind and supportive staff, talks with partners were very interesting too. Took a lot of effort and hard work but, after 2 months of intense job hunting and 800+ applications,... Read More

Miguel
Graduated: 2023

1/21/2024

Course
Software Development Bootcamp

Overall

Curriculum

Job Support

"Finding Direction in the Coding Sea: A Northcoders Tale"

"Several years after completing my degree in Engineering in Informatics Sciences, life circumstances led me away from my career. Returning proved challenging without the necessary consistency and discipline, much like trying to learn a new swimming style... Read More

Luke Kidwell
Junior Data Engineer | Graduated: 2023

12/26/2023

Overall

Curriculum

Job Support

"Excellent learning experience"

Pros: Excellent learning experience (seminars, katas) Cons: Lack of coordination between teaching team and careers team. e.g. expectation for completing CV before completing projects (for most job switchers the projects are going to be the most important... Read More

Person thinking

Need help making a decision?

We'll match you to the perfect bootcamp for your location, budget, and future career.